Storm window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ged storm windows and installing new units to improve a building’s insulation and protection. This process typically includes assessing the existing window setup, selecting appropriate replacement storm windows, and ensuring proper installation to achieve optimal performance. The service aims to enhance energy efficiency by reducing drafts and heat loss, while also providing an additional barrier against the elements. Proper installation by experienced professionals helps ensure the new storm windows function effectively and maintain the aesthetic appeal of the property.

Replacing storm windows addresses common issues such as drafts, air leaks, and condensation between window panes. Over time, storm windows can become warped, cracked, or damaged, diminishing their ability to insulate and protect the interior of a property. Upgrading to new storm windows can lead to improved comfort inside the building, lower energy bills, and increased durability of the window system. Additionally, new storm windows can help prevent water infiltration and reduce noise from outside, contributing to a more comfortable indoor environment.

Cost Range for Storm Window Replacement - The typical cost for replacing storm windows varies between $300 and $800 per window, depending on size and material choices.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project requirements.

Factors Influencing Costs - Installation costs are influenced by the number of windows, their size, and the type of storm window selected, such as aluminum or vinyl. Additional features like energy-efficient glazing may increase the overall expense. Budget considerations should be discussed with local service providers.

Average Project Expenses - For a standard home in Nottingham, MD, replacing multiple storm windows might range from $1,200 to $3,000, depending on the scope. Single-window replacements typically fall within the $150 to $400 range. Local contractors can help determine precise costs based on the home's specifics.

Cost Variability - Prices for storm window replacement can vary widely based on the complexity of installation and regional labor rates. It’s advisable to obtain multiple quotes from local pros to compare options and ensure accurate budgeting. No matter the project size, professionals can assist in estimating cost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m window replacement services? Storm window replacement involves installing new storm windows to improve insulation, reduce energy costs, and enhance home protection against weather elements.

How do I know if my storm windows need replacing? Signs include difficulty opening or closing, condensation between panes, or visible damage like cracks or warping.

What should I consider when choosing new storm windows? Factors include material durability, energy efficiency features, compatibility with existing windows, and local climate conditions.

How long does storm window replacement typically take? The duration varies depending on the number of windows and complexity of installation, but most projects are completed within a day or two.
